#ifndef TRITON_CONVERSION_FMA_DOT_UTILITY_H #define TRITON_CONVERSION_FMA_DOT_UTILITY_H #include "mlir/Conversion/LLVMCommon/TypeConverter.h" #include "mlir/Support/LLVM.h" #include "mlir/Transforms/DialectConversion.h" #include "triton/Dialect/Triton/IR/Dialect.h" namespace mlir::triton::gpu { /// Abstract interface for scalar multiplication of Value vectors. /// /// Enable generation of hardware specific code in different backends. class FMAVectorMultiplier { public: /// \returns scalar product of two arrays, plus c: a·b + c virtual Value multiplyVectors(ArrayRef a, ArrayRef b, Value c) = 0; virtual ~FMAVectorMultiplier() = default; }; /// Implements a framework for FMA dot conversion to llvm. /// /// This function implements architecture independent part of FMA dot /// conversion and calls "multiplier" object, which is defined by caller /// and implements architecture dependant part of conversion. LogicalResult parametricConvertFMADot(DotOp op, DotOp::Adaptor adaptor, const LLVMTypeConverter *typeConverter, ConversionPatternRewriter &rewriter, FMAVectorMultiplier &multiplier); } // namespace mlir::triton::gpu #endif // TRITON_CONVERSION_FMA_DOT_UTILITY_H
